The Maintenance Worker provides maintenance repair of structures and mechanical equipment, and perform general custodial tasks under the direction of the Facilities Maintenance Manager. This position reports to both campuses, although the staff will continue to have a regular campus they report to weekly. This position will be working the evening shift.
Work Location:
Chalon Campus (West Los Angeles). Evening Shift.

Duties and Responsibilities:
Assists the Facilities Maintenance Manager, as needed Assists with the maintenance and general repairs of building and set-ups for both the Facilities Management Department Keeps supervisor informed regarding the status of work orders Watches for, and immediately advise supervisor of, potentially dangerous situations, and check with supervisor before attempting any repairs (in both minor and potentially dangerous situations) Assists with the moving of furniture and equipment, as required Learns and utilizes approved methods of operating, adjusting, maintaining and repairing department equipment Provides assistance with custodial duties, as assigned
Other Duties and Responsibilities:
Maintain the pool's chemical composition Dispose of trash on a daily basis Perform other duties, as assigned
Requirements:
Knowledge:
Some working knowledge of plumbing, electrical, carpentry, painting, housekeeping, heating and glazing. General knowledge of tools and equipment related to the department's functioning.
Abilities and Skills:
Make ordinary repairs related to plumbing, electrical and other problems. Effectively organize, prioritize and handle multiple tasks to meet established deadlines. Ability to easily learn more types of simple and complex repairs as well as to use equipment. Ability to accurately understand and follow verbal and written instructions. Recognize potentially dangerous situations and effectively communicate them to the supervisor. Analytical, detail-oriented, accurate and a proactive problem solver. Exercise good judgment. Strong general maintenance, customer service, oral communication, interpersonal skills. Good written communication skills. Bi-lingual English/Spanish highly desired.
Education:
High school diploma or equivalent. Some maintenance-related courses at a trade school. Valid California driver's license desired.
Experience:
One year experience in a handyman position within an apartment complex or manufacturing company. Some experience in a building trade. Demonstrate records of good driving desired.
